From physiotherapy to engineering - meet Ryan, apprentice engineer at BAE Systems in Cowes, Isle of Wight 🌊 "The chance to work on world-leading technology, such as advanced radar systems, really excited me." Ryan made a bold career switch and hasn’t looked back. Through BAE Systems’ Higher Engineering Apprenticeship, he’s gained hands-on experience, a qualification in electrical and electronic engineering, and real project responsibility - including designing printed circuit boards destined for global projects. Working in Cowes offers more than career development - it brings a lifestyle surrounded by coastline, community, and innovation.
